Extra day of racing added |
CHIPPIE powered by UTS joins St.Maarten Heineken Regatta

SIMPSON BAY—the 27th
edition of the St.Maarten Heineken Regatta will feature an extra day of
racing. The announcement was made during a press conference at the Sint
Maarten Yacht Club yesterday. Organizers of the Caribbean’s largest
regatta also announced that CHIPPIE powered by UTS has been added to
the list of many businesses that sponsor the “Serious Fun” event.
The extra day of racing will be held Thursday March 1 and is intended
for Spinnaker Classes only. The day will consist of 2 to 3 windward -
leeward races. The traditional three-day race schedule will set sail
starting Friday March 2 and continue
through to Sunday March 4. “We want to cater more to the performance
boats,” said Robbie Ferron, Chairman of the Regatta Steering Committee.
Ferron likened the high performance racers to the fashion industries
top designers. They create and set trends. He explained that by
attracting top racers to St.Maarten the regatta would establish the
sailing trends for the Caribbean. “We’ve been the biggest regatta in
the Caribbean for six years now,” Ferron noted. “We have no real
interest in getting bigger. If it happens fine, but we always strive to
get better.” The extra day of sailing has been added to the weekend
schedule a day before the traditional racing starts. “Most of the boats
are already here on Thursday,” said Ferron. The additional racing will
be scored separately from the rest of the regatta and will feature its
own trophy. The race will sailed for the Commodores Cup. However,
Ferron implied the name could change if another sponsor stepped
forward.
Ferron
called the addition of CHIPPIE and UTS as sponsors of the regatta a
perfect match. He said both groups are focused, have a vision for the
future and an innovative plan to get better. “We are pleased to be
involved in the promotion of St.Maarten and to be associated with the
St.Maarten Heineken Regatta and its many sponsors,” said Glenn Carty of
UTS. “We are particularly proud to be the official mobile phone service
provider.” Several of the regatta sponsors, including John Leone, the
managing director of Heineken St.Maarten were on hand at the press
conference to officially welcome CHIPPIE.
